This is a piece I hate to part with because I doubt I'll ever see another one. Unfortunately, I have to downsize, and I no longer have a safe place in which to display it. Measuring 14" in diameter, It was produced by Vernon Kilns, I believe in the late 1930's, and was designed by Harry Bird. The pattern name is Fantail. The background is a gorgeous matte white, with a hand-painted tropical fish motif which is slightly raised and done in a glossy finish. The condition is great - it was clearly not used as tableware. T is a minute chip on the rim at approximately 10 o'clock, but it's too small to photograph. T's also a glaze pop (manufacturing flaw) just to the right of the bubble near the tail.
